package org.springmodules.hivemind;
import org.apache.hivemind.Registry;
import org.springframework.beans.factory.FactoryBean;
import org.springframework.beans.factory.InitializingBean;
import org.springframework.context.ApplicationContextException;
import org.springframework.util.Assert;
/**
* FactoryBean
implementation that acts as an adapter to a HiveMind Registry
* allowing for any HiveMind service to be exposed as a Spring bean.
*
* Both the serviceInterface
and registry
properties are required. By default,
* services are retreived from the HiveMind Registry
using the service interface only.
* If a value is supplied for the serviceName
property, then both the service interface
* and service name will be used when looking for the service in HiveMind.
*
* @author Rob Harrop
* @author Thierry Templier
* @see Registry
* @see RegistryFactoryBean
* @see #setServiceInterface(Class)
* @see #setServiceName(String)
* @see #setRegistry(org.apache.hivemind.Registry)
*/
public class ServiceFactoryBean implements FactoryBean, InitializingBean {
/**
* The HiveMind Registry
from which services are accessed.
*/
private Registry registry;
/**
* The name of the HiveMind service to access.
*/
private String serviceName;
/**
* The Class
name of the of the HiveMind service.
*/
private Class serviceInterface;
/**
* Sets the interface of the HiveMind service to be accessed.
*/
public void setServiceInterface(Class serviceInterface) {
Assert.isTrue(serviceInterface.isInterface(), "Cannot use a Class for the service interface");
this.serviceInterface = serviceInterface;
}
/**
* Sets the service name of the HiveMind service to be accessed.
*/
public void setServiceName(String serviceName) {
this.serviceName = serviceName;
}
/**
* Sets the HiveMind Registry
used to load services.
*/
public void setRegistry(Registry registry) {
this.registry = registry;
}
/**
* Gets the Hivemind service from the Registry
.
*/
public Object getObject() throws Exception {
return getServiceObject();
}
public Class getObjectType() {
// can we use singletons and cache here?
return getServiceObject().getClass();
}
public boolean isSingleton() {
return false;
}
/**
* Checks if the registry and serviceInterface properties are specified. If no corresponding service is
* configured in the Hivemind Registry
, an ApplicationContextException
is thrown.
*/
public void afterPropertiesSet() throws Exception {
if (registry == null) {
throw new ApplicationContextException("Property [registry] of class [" + ServiceFactoryBean.class
+ "] is required.");
}
if (serviceInterface == null) {
throw new ApplicationContextException("Property [serviceInterface] of class [" + ServiceFactoryBean.class
+ "] is required.");
}
// check that the service exists for fail fast behaviour
boolean containsService = false;
if (serviceName == null) {
containsService = registry.containsService(serviceInterface);
}
else {
containsService = registry.containsService(serviceName, serviceInterface);
}
if (!containsService) {
throw new ApplicationContextException("Service with interface [" + serviceInterface.getName() +
"] and name [" + serviceName + "] is not present in registry.");
}
}
/**
* Get the Hivemind service from the Registry
.
*/
private Object getServiceObject() {
if (serviceName == null) {
return registry.getService(serviceInterface);
}
else {
return registry.getService(serviceName, serviceInterface);
}
}
}
